Should unemployment regulations and benefits be changed?

According to the Employment Security Department, “Unemployment benefits are made available through taxes paid by your former employer(s) to partially replace your regular earnings and help you meet expenses while you look for another job. These benefits are intended to assist workers who lost their jobs through no fault of their own, and are not based on financial need. While receiving benefits, it is still your responsibility to get back to work as quickly as you can.” According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, as June 2015 the nation unemployment rate is 5.3%, which are 16,960,000 people without unemployment.
